Regional Deep Dive

The Utility Asset Management Market is experiencing significant growth across regions, driven by the need for efficient resource management, aging infrastructure, and the integration of advanced technology. North America is characterized by a strong focus on regulatory compliance and sustainable practices, while Europe is focusing on digital transformation and smart grids. Asia-Pacific is characterized by rapid urbanization and investment in renewable energy, which is reshaping asset management strategies. Middle East & Africa is characterized by resource scarcity and economic diversification, while Latin America is characterized by public-private partnership models to improve utility services.

Europe

  • The European Union's Green Deal is driving utilities to adopt sustainable asset management practices, with a focus on reducing carbon emissions and enhancing energy efficiency.
  • Innovations in digital twin technology are being adopted by firms such as Siemens and Schneider Electric, allowing for real-time monitoring and predictive maintenance of utility assets.

Asia Pacific

  • China's commitment to achieving carbon neutrality by 2060 is prompting significant investments in smart grid technologies and renewable energy assets, reshaping utility asset management strategies.
  • Countries like India are implementing the Smart Cities Mission, which includes modernizing utility infrastructure and enhancing asset management through digital solutions.

Latin America

  • Brazil's National Electric Energy Agency (ANEEL) is encouraging the adoption of smart meters and digital asset management systems to improve service delivery and operational efficiency.
  • Public-private partnerships in countries like Colombia are facilitating investments in utility infrastructure, enhancing asset management capabilities in the region.

North America

  • The implementation of the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act in the U.S. is expected to boost funding for utility infrastructure projects, enhancing asset management capabilities.
  • Companies like Duke Energy and Pacific Gas and Electric are investing in advanced analytics and IoT technologies to optimize asset performance and reduce operational costs.

Middle East And Africa

  • The UAE's Energy Strategy 2050 aims to increase the contribution of clean energy in the total energy mix, leading to advancements in utility asset management practices.
  •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030 is promoting the adoption of smart technologies in utility management, with companies like Saudi Electricity Company leading the charge.

Segmental Market Size

The utility asset management market is growing steadily, driven by the growing need for resource management and compliance with regulatory requirements. There are also many other factors driving the market, such as the increasing focus on operational efficiency and the integration of smart grids into utility operations. In addition, regulatory requirements to reduce the carbon footprint of operations and increase the level of sustainability also encourage the investment in asset management solutions. It is in the implementation stage now, with companies like Schneider Electric and Siemens as the market leaders. North America and Europe are in the forefront, implementing projects that use IoT and AI for the purposes of predictive maintenance. The main applications are grid management, asset life cycle management and risk assessment. The goal is to optimize performance and minimize downtime. In the future, it is expected that the integration of renewable energy sources and the digitalization of utility operations will drive the market, while technological developments such as machine learning and cloud computing will continue to shape its development.
